A transistor is a device that controls the flow of electricity in electronic equipment and has at least three electrodes. Typically, transistors consist of three layers, or terminals, of a semiconductor material, each of which can carry a current. A transistor is a miniature semiconductor that regulates or controls current or voltage flow in addition to amplifying and generating these electrical signals and acting as a switch or gate for them. A transistor is a semiconductor device that can control or amplify electric current or voltage. A transistor is an electronic component that controls current or voltage with a small signal.
